To increase the energy levels in the body you should follow some tips-
# Eat a balanced diet. Do not skip meals. Make sure the foods you eat are loaded with vital nutrients. Make sure your diet consists of at least 50 percent complex carbohydrates.Avoid fatty foods.Foods high in saturated fats are disastrous for your cholesterol levels and your waistline and they can lower the amount of oxygen in your bloodstream causing you to feel sleepy after eating.
# Exercise is very necessary to increase the energy.You should try to exercise five times a week for 30 minutes each time. If you're unsure of what kind of exercise to do, try walking.
# Water is an essential part of any plan to boost energy, so make sure you get your 8 glasses a day. When the body is dehydrated, it generates energy less efficiently. A study at Tufts University found that just a 1-2% drop in your water levels can impair your thinking. If you find 8 glasses hard to stomach, increase water-rich foods in your diet, such as watermelon, cucumbers or soups.
# Have a proper sleep.If you want to avoid the numerous side effects that come along with insufficient sleep, then you need to sleep the recommended number of hours each night and make sure it's of high quality. Children from the ages of 3 up to the age of 12 need between 9 and 12 hours of sleep per night, while teenagers need 9 hours of sleep and adults, 7 to 8 hours.
# Doing meditation also helps in increasing energy levels.A three- to five-minute meditation session can make you feel calmer and increase your energy levels. It also helps deal with stress, which can also sap your energy.
# Lastly,Have at least 4-5 meals a day which will help to increase your metabolism and don't ever skip your Break fast.this will help you to be energetic through out the day.
